At present, February 2022 is the month with the most blockbusters ever, and the competition is particularly fierce, and some of the games released in February are as follows: (tips: The following are all sorted by time)
"Fading Light 2" 2022-2-04
"Master" 2022-2-08
"Crossfire X" 2022-2-10
"Legend of Heroes: Trail of Dawn" 2022-2-10
"Sword Dance Matchless" 2022-2-17
Warhammer: Total War 3 2022-2-17
"King of Fighters 15" 2022-2-17
Horizon: Forbidden Lands in the West 2022-2-18
Eldon's Ring of Law 2022-2-25
"Sophie's Alchemy Workshop 2: The Alchemist of Incredible Dreams" 2022-2-25

Overall, February 2022 can be called the strongest launch month at present, why is this so? I think most of the games have been postponed because of the pandemic, and many foreign companies have ended their fiscal years in March.
